Market Overview and Core Challenges

The global bottle display packaging market has demonstrated consistent growth, reaching an estimated valuation of 2,785.5 million USD in the base year of 2025. This trajectory reflects a compound annual growth rate of 6.22 percent over the forecast period extending to 2032, suggesting a maturing industry that is expanding alongside broader retail and beverage consumption trends. The market size has steadily climbed from approximately 2,050.4 million USD in 2020, indicating that demand for specialized display solutions is not merely cyclical but tied to structural shifts in how products are merchandised and consumed. As the market approaches a projected valuation of over 4,200 million USD by the end of the forecast window, stakeholders must navigate a landscape defined by both opportunity and complexity.

One of the primary challenges facing the sector is the tension between sustainability mandates and cost efficiency. The industry relies heavily on fiber-based materials, particularly corrugated cardboard, which remains the dominant material type due to its balance of strength, recyclability, and cost. However, the price volatility of raw materials poses a significant risk. For instance, the global price index for corrugated paperboard, the primary material for bottle displays, stood at 145 in the fourth quarter of 2025, with a baseline of 100 set in 2010. Meanwhile, virgin kraft linerboard prices averaged 850 USD per ton in North America during 2025. These input cost pressures squeeze margins for manufacturers while forcing retailers to reconsider the economic viability of elaborate display structures.

Regulatory fragmentation represents another critical juncture. In Europe, the Packaging and Packaging Waste Regulation mandates that paper packaging must contain 40 percent recycled content by 2030. Concurrently, the European Commission Directive banned single-use plastic display packaging in retail settings across member states since 2024. In North America, California’s SB 54 requires 30 percent post-consumer recycled content in rigid plastic packaging by 2028. These regulations create a compliance patchwork where solutions viable in one region may face barriers in another. For multinational brands, harmonizing display packaging strategies across these divergent requirements adds layers of complexity to design and sourcing.

Finally, the market exhibits a moderate level of concentration, with the top three companies holding approximately 21.4 percent of the market share and the top five reaching 33.8 percent. This fragmented landscape suggests room for consolidation but also indicates that regional players and niche specialists retain significant influence. The challenge for larger incumbents is scaling sustainable innovations without losing the agility to serve specific local retail needs, while smaller players must find ways to comply with stringent regulations without the economies of scale enjoyed by market leaders. Successfully navigating these dynamics requires more than operational efficiency; it demands a strategic reevaluation of material choices, supply chain resilience, and regulatory foresight.

Technological Innovation and Material Breakthroughs

Innovation in material science is redefining what bottle display packaging can achieve. The push for sustainability has accelerated the development of high-performance paper-based solutions that can replace traditional plastics without compromising structural integrity. A notable example occurred in October 2025, when Smurfit Kappa launched a fiber bottle carrier display packaging using 100 percent recyclable paperboard for beverage bottles. This product launch underscores a broader industry trend where manufacturers are engineering displays that maintain functionality while aligning with end-of-life recyclability goals. Similarly, the focus on modular designs allows for greater flexibility in retail environments. In June 2025, WestRock exhibited sustainable bottle display stands at Pack Expo International featuring modular designs, highlighting how engineering advancements enable retailers to configure displays for varying shelf spaces and promotional needs. Such innovations reduce waste and improve supply chain efficiency by allowing components to be reused or adapted across different campaigns.

Policy and Regulatory Environment

Regulatory frameworks are acting as both a constraint and a catalyst for change. The mandate for 40 percent recycled content in paper packaging by 2030 in the European Union forces manufacturers to rethink material sourcing and processing. This regulatory pressure drives investment in recycling infrastructure and encourages the adoption of circular economy principles. The ban on single-use plastic display packaging in EU retail settings since 2024 has already shifted demand toward paper-based and corrugated alternatives. In the United States, California’s requirement for 30 percent post-consumer recycled content in rigid plastic packaging by 2028 extends the influence of regulation beyond regional borders, as companies often standardize packaging strategies across states to manage complexity. These policies are effectively raising the barrier to entry for non-compliant materials and rewarding companies that have already integrated sustainability into their core product development pipelines.

Demand-Side Changes and Consumer Behavior

On the demand side, consumer preferences are increasingly influencing upstream packaging decisions. Retailers and brands are under pressure to demonstrate environmental responsibility, and packaging is a highly visible touchpoint for consumers. Displays that are perceived as wasteful or non-recyclable can negatively impact brand perception. Consequently, there is growing demand for point-of-sale displays that not only enhance product visibility but also communicate sustainability credentials. The rise of e-commerce and omnichannel retailing also plays a role. While traditional brick-and-mortar displays remain crucial, the need for packaging that can transition seamlessly from store displays to direct delivery without sacrificing protection or aesthetics is growing. This dual requirement pushes manufacturers to design versatile solutions that serve multiple channels, thereby increasing the value proposition of high-quality display packaging.

Accelerated Transition to Circular Materials

The trajectory toward circularity will intensify. As regulations tighten and consumer expectations rise, the market will see a broader adoption of display packaging made from high percentages of recycled content. Innovations in paperboard technology will enable displays that match the durability of traditional materials while meeting recycled content mandates. This shift creates opportunities for suppliers who can secure reliable streams of high-quality recycled fibers and for brands that can leverage sustainable packaging to enhance their market positioning. However, the availability of recycled materials may become a bottleneck if collection and processing infrastructure does not keep pace with demand, potentially leading to supply constraints and price premiums for certified recycled content.

Integration of Digital and Physical Merchandising

The convergence of digital and physical retail experiences will influence display design. Packaging that incorporates elements compatible with digital traceability, such as QR codes or smart labels, will become more prevalent. Displays may serve as data collection points or interactive touchpoints that engage consumers and provide brands with valuable insights. This trend opens avenues for companies that can integrate digital features into physical packaging without adding significant cost or complexity. The risk lies in ensuring that added digital elements do not compromise recyclability or increase material usage, which could run counter to sustainability goals.

Regionalization of Supply Chains

Supply chain regionalization is likely to deepen. In response to cost volatility and regulatory differences, companies may prioritize local sourcing and manufacturing to reduce lead times and ensure compliance with regional standards. This could lead to a more fragmented global supply network but also greater resilience. For businesses, this means evaluating suppliers not just on cost but on their ability to meet local regulatory requirements and respond quickly to market changes. The challenge will be balancing the efficiencies of scale with the flexibility of regional operations, as maintaining consistent quality and sustainability standards across multiple regions can be operationally demanding.
